About

Jürgen Weiser is a scholar working on Materials Chemistry, Molecular Biology and Physical and Theoretical Chemistry. According to data from OpenAlex, Jürgen Weiser has authored 9 papers receiving a total of 685 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 8 papers in Materials Chemistry, 6 papers in Molecular Biology and 4 papers in Physical and Theoretical Chemistry. Recurrent topics in Jürgen Weiser’s work include Porphyrin and Phthalocyanine Chemistry (8 papers), Porphyrin Metabolism and Disorders (4 papers) and Photosynthetic Processes and Mechanisms (4 papers). Jürgen Weiser is often cited by papers focused on Porphyrin and Phthalocyanine Chemistry (8 papers), Porphyrin Metabolism and Disorders (4 papers) and Photosynthetic Processes and Mechanisms (4 papers). Jürgen Weiser collaborates with scholars based in Germany. Jürgen Weiser's co-authors include Heinz A. Staab, Judi Bryant, Linda M. Tunstad, Donald J. Cram, Roger C. Helgeson, John A. Tucker, John C. Sherman, Enrico Dalcanale, Carolyn B. Knobler and Claus Krieger and has published in prestigious journals such as The Journal of Organic Chemistry, Tetrahedron and Tetrahedron Letters.
